Coal Spillage Charge Rate definition

Coal Spillage Charge Rate means, in respect of each Coal Vehicle used in a Service, the coal spillage charge rate per kgtm for that Coal Vehicle, for the Relevant Year ending 31 March 2019 only, as set out in the track usage price list published by Network Rail on or around 20 December 2013 and adjusted in accordance with paragraph 2.7.2 of the version of this contract that was in force up until 31 March 2019;
Coal Spillage Charge Rate means, in respect of each Coal Vehicle used in a Service, the coal spillage charge rate per KGTM for that Coal Vehicle, as set out in the Track Usage Price List and adjusted in accordance with paragraph 2.7.2;
Coal Spillage Charge Rate means, in respect of each Coal Vehicle, the coal spillage charge rate per KGTM determined in accordance with paragraph 2.11.1, as adjusted in accordance with paragraph 2.7.2;

More Definitions of Coal Spillage Charge Rate

Coal Spillage Charge Rate means, in respect of each Coal Vehicle used in a Service, the coal spillage charge rate per kgtm for that Coal Vehicle, for the Relevant Year ending 31 March 2019 only, as set out in the track usage price list published by Network Rail on or around 20 December 2013 and, being an Indexed Figure, adjusted in accordance with paragraph 2.7.2 of the version of this contract that was in force up until 31 March 2019; [Network Rail comment: Definition reinstated as this rate is still referred to in item 6 of paragraph 2.2.1. It has been amended slightly to reflect that it will be calculated in accordance with the version of the track usage price list and the contract that was in force up until 31 March 2019.]
